Emotional Attachment vs. Real-World Value
Your first car carries memories, but the market does not see sentiment: it sees numbers. After five years, the majority of cars in India depreciate by about 45–55% of their original price, depending upon the condition.
The trick lies in separating emotional worth from financial reality. Sentiment makes you overprice the car, whereas the market rewards condition, mileage and demand. That is where a quick used car valuation check can help you see what your car is actually worth with real-time data.
The Cost of Holding On Too Long
Most of the first-time owners delay selling by saying that the car still runs fine. However, the economic value and the running condition of a car are not the same.
Maintenance and repair bills tend to rise as cars age; owners commonly see routine service bills of a few thousand rupees per year for small hatchbacks, rising if major consumables or driveline parts need replacement In the meantime, the resale value continues to decline. Most owners usually lose a year or two of better resale value by the time they make the decision to sell. Many sellers find the 3–6 year window offering a good balance, as the car is still modern and attracts stronger buyer demand, which can help preserve resale value.

Spotting the Right Time to Exit Before Value Drops Further
Every car has a financial expiry date. There comes a time when it does not make sense to keep it. If your maintenance expenses in a year are piling up, rather than spending money on maintenance, it is better to sell and invest in something more modern and efficient.
A used car valuation tool can help you understand whether your car is still in the high-demand zone, when it is losing resale momentum or is under regulatory restraint such as age restrictions.
